What would you do if you met an alien outer space? 7. 1 don't believe the existence … Web13 mrt. 2024 · When n=3, then l can equal 2, and when l=2, m can equal 2, 1, 0, -1, and -2. The l=2 orbitals are called d orbitals, and there are five different ones corresponding to the different values of m. Web14 okt. 2024 · Hi! n=2 has four orbitals because energy level 2 includes the single s orbital as well as the three p orbitals (px, py, and pz). The point of confusion might be that two electrons can fit in each orbital, so you may have thought there were two s orbitals, when there's really one s orbital with two electrons in it. WebAn atomic orbital is characterized by three quantum numbers. The principal quantum number, n, can be any positive integer. The general region for value of energy of the orbital and the average distance of an electron from the nucleus are related to n. Orbitals having the same value of n are said to be in the same shell.
